Cabo San Lucas:

The popular Mexican resort of Cabo San Lucas is considered one of the best places on the planet for recreational and sport fishing. Read more about fishing in Cabo San Lucas

Its diverse marine life and excellent climate are beyond comparison. Even if you are just beginning to learn the basics of this fascinating activity, Cabo San Lucas is the perfect place to get your first fishing experience.

  • This resort town is tacitly called the «Marlin Capital of the World» due to the fact that it is easier to catch Marlin fish here than anywhere else on Earth.

Its waters are home to striped, blue and black Marlin, as well as many other fish: trout bass, dorada, wahoo, sailfish, etc. A definite plus is that you can go fishing in Cabo whenever you want, regardless of the time of year.

Mazatlan:

In addition to being one of the most visited resorts in Mexico, Mazatlan is also one of the best places in the country for recreational fishing. Dorada, tuna, and all kinds of marlin are found here in great numbers.

And if perch is the goal of your trip, Mazatlan is truly the best choice. In addition to the rich marine waters, there are two lakes (El Salto and Comedero) where you can catch Florida black bass.

Sport fishing tournaments are often held in Mazatlán, with sailfish and swordfish fishing being particularly popular. Fishing tours can be booked with local operators, and the prices will be lower than in the other resort towns of Mexico.

Puerto Vallarta:

The popular Mexican resort town of Puerto Vallarta has long been beloved by fishing enthusiasts, as its waters are rich in large fish such as marlin, sailfish, tuna, and even shark. Read more about fishing in Puerto Vallarta

The town is also famous for its fishing club, the Club de Pesca, which holds an annual red snapper, humpback whiting, dorado and other fishing tournaments. Over a period of 4 days, competitions are held, and at the end the winners are awarded valuable prizes. If you would also like to participate, the club’s official website allows you to register for the tournament by paying a specified fee.

A popular location for off-season fishing in Puerto Vallarta is the Bay of Bahia de las Banderas, where you can fish for spinning, jigging or deep-sea fishing. The resort offers a wide variety of fishing tours for all budgets, from fancy yachts to cheaper boats. Choose what’s right for you!

Cancun:

Cancun is another popular Mexican destination for fishing enthusiasts. Its waters are home to about 450 varieties of fish, among which are quite a few large deep-sea dwellers. Swimming With a Whale Shark in Cancun

Blue marlin, spiny pelamid, amberjack, tuna, grouper and many other sea creatures can be caught here. Local operators of fishing tours provide vacationers with boats and boats for rent, equipped with all necessary equipment. For fans of sport fishing various tournaments are held, participation in which will be remembered for a long time.
